Description

Perfect for experienced paddlers and beginners alike, the Old Town Dirigo 106 Recreational Kayak provides a roomy cockpit and excellent initial stability. Packed with features, the Dirigo 106 boasts a Click Seal hatch with bulkhead, a glove box hatch for small items like keys or cell phones, retractable carry handles, a paddle keeper, a perimeter safety line, and more. A contoured poly seat and easy-grip thigh pads provide comfort and stability for a full day out on the water. Enjoy added leverage and control with the Dirigo 106's Glide Track foot brace system, while the three-layer polyethylene Stabil-form hull design ensures a stable and efficient ride. This ten-foot, six-inch kayak has an impressive 300-pound maximum load capacity and features a limited lifetime warranty. Paddle sold separately.   • Perfect Versatile Sit In Kayak for all Ages and Experience Levels
Color: Sunrise
I Absolutely LOVE this KAYAK! I've had it for about 5 years now and besides a few scratches on the bottom and some modification I've made, it looks brand new! All I do is wipe it down with a sponge after use! This sit-in Kayak (SINK) is made of a (3) layer polyethylene, I bought the Sunrise (Yellow/Orange) edition and it has been a breeze to paddle in and work on! This Dirigo 106 comes with an adjustable seat, adjustable foot peddles, outer thigh pads, 2 cupholders (one on the dash and one between your legs!), a quick release bungee paddle holder, bungee rigging on the front and back of the kayak, as well as a large waterproof compartment in the dash and a waterproof locking compartment under the back hatch! The handles on either end make it very easy for 2 people to handle, but honestly, at 49 lbs, I can grab it off my Jeep and handle it myself. This kayak does come in an Angler Edition (rod holder attachment in dash and 2 rod holders built in behind the seat) but I decided to get the standard edition, and customize it myself, which I'm glad I did. I like to fish, so I made a fishing crate to attach behind my seat. This crate has more than 2 rod holders as well as tons of storage and extra goodies. I also cut a small hole in the dash and installed a Scotty Rod Holder, exactly where it would have came in the Angler Edition! Another modification was to put an Anchor Trolley system on the left side to allow me to anchor and change direction while fishing. All the modifications were surprisingly easy and believe it or not, I didn't mess it up. I've taken this kayak in rivers, ponds, lakes, and oceans and it has performed great in all! When kayaking in rougher waters, I can attach a spray skirt to the rim around the seat to keep all the water out. The large water tight storage compartment in the back is large enough to accommodate whatever task I may be doing for the day, and the large space at the nose of my kayak allows me to store even more good! (there's even ample space behind the seat to put quite a few things.) There is also enough room on the deck for my small dog to join my comfortably! This Kayak has been one of the best investments of my life, and I tell everyone it's probably the cheapest and easiest way to get on the water! I can take this kayak into about 8 inches of water, so there are very few limits to it. Upkeep consists of wiping it down after use, and repairs, if any, were all simple. This is a comfortable kayak for a day on the water, or a river adventure! It has fit my lifestyle perfect and I can't wait to start using it again this summer! 10/10 ... show more

  • Perfect for lakes and slow rivers
Color: Black Cherry
The stability and storage capacity of this kayak are the biggest pros for me. It's comfortable for multi-day float and camping trips and it handles perfectly with the extra weight of camping gear. The cockpit is roomy, but it isn't so wide that it's hard to paddle. It's easy to carry so it's no hassle getting it from your car/truck to the water. The only con I've noticed is that it doesn't track well. I don't fish with this model (this isn't the Angler model) so it's not a real turn off for me. Although, because it doesn't track spectacularly, that makes it incredibly easy to steer. With one or two good strokes you can stay clear of river sweepers and other obstacles very quickly and effortlessly. You can't beat this level of comfort and utility for the price. ... show more
